Why One Campaign Medal Exists in Several Metals

7 min read

A campaign medal catalog number describes a design, not an object. The same dies were regularly used to strike the design in brass, copper, white metal and gilt, and each of those is a separate collectible piece with its own scarcity, its own grade and its own price. Reading a catalog number without reading the metal alongside it is the most common way collectors buy the wrong medal.

What Does the Metal Tell You That the Number Does Not?

The catalog number answers what the design is: whose campaign, which year, which obverse and reverse pairing. It says nothing about what the piece in the holder is physically made of.

That matters because the same dies were used across multiple metals. A die pairing catalogued once might be struck in brass for the crowd, copper for a slightly better keepsake, white metal because it was cheap and took an impression well, and gilt or silver for presentation to people the campaign wanted to flatter.

The result is one number describing four or more genuinely different objects. They differ in how many were made, how well they survived, and what collectors will pay.

Which Metals Were Actually Used?

Nineteenth-century campaign medals turn up most often in a small set of materials, each chosen for cost or effect rather than aesthetics alone.

The economics were straightforward. A campaign needed volume, and volume meant base metal. Brass and white metal could be struck cheaply enough to hand out at rallies, which is why they dominate surviving populations. Copper sat slightly above them. Gilt and silver were made in small numbers for people the campaign wanted to impress, which is precisely why they are scarce now.

Lead sits outside that logic. It appears occasionally as a trial striking or an oddity rather than a distribution piece, and because it is so soft, examples that survive at all tend to carry damage.

Metals commonly seen on campaign medals, and what each implies
MetalLabel abbreviationTypical roleSurvival characteristics
BrassBRASSGeneral distribution, the workhorse metalDurable, often found with wear and rim knocks
CopperCUSlightly better general issueTones over time; colour designation affects value
White metalWMCheap, takes a sharp impressionSoft, marks easily, high grades are scarce
GiltGILTPresentation or premium issueGilding wears at the high points first
SilverARPresentation, smallest numbersScarcest striking of most designs
LeadLEADTrial or uncommon strikingVery soft, frequently damaged or corroded

A Worked Example: One Number, Three Metals

The Horatio Seymour design catalogued as DeWitt HS 1868-11 is a clean illustration because this collection holds three strikings of it at once.

All three are the same 18 millimetre design from the 1868 campaign, and all three graded Mint State 63. What separates them is entirely the metal: one in brass, one in copper, one in white metal. The copper example carries an additional RB colour designation that the others cannot have.

Line them up and the point is obvious. Same design, same grade, three different pieces, three different markets. A collector working a Seymour set may want all three; a collector working a type set wants whichever is most attractive.

The pattern repeats wherever a design was struck across a price range. An 1888 Cleveland design exists here in both brass and silver, and the silver is the one that was never made in quantity. Neither label is more correct than the other; they simply describe different objects that happen to share a number.

Why Do Copper and Brass Get Extra Letters?

Copper-based pieces change colour as they age, and grading services record that as part of the grade because it drives value.

RD means red, the original mint colour retained. RB means red brown, partially toned. BN means brown, fully toned. The numeric grade measures preservation; the colour designation measures how much original surface remains.

Two medals can both be MS 63 and be worth very different amounts if one is RD and the other BN. On nineteenth-century campaign material, full red is genuinely uncommon, so BN and RB are the normal expectation rather than a disappointment.

White metal, gilt and silver take no colour designation, which is why their labels look shorter. That absence is informative in itself: if you see a colour letter, you are looking at a copper-based piece regardless of what the surface looks like under gallery lighting.

Is the Rarest Metal Always the Most Valuable?

Not reliably, and this is where collectors overpay.

A silver striking is usually the scarcest of a design, and often the most valuable. But scarcity only converts to price where demand exists. A scarce striking of a design nobody collects stays cheap, while a common striking of a famous design stays expensive.

Condition frequently outweighs metal. A white metal piece in exceptional preservation can beat a silver example with problems, because the soft alloy makes high grades genuinely hard to find. A surface problem carries its own penalty regardless of material, which is covered in what a Details grade means. Provenance is a third axis again, independent of both.

The practical approach is to compare like with like: same catalog number, same metal, same grade. Anything else is comparing different objects.

How Do You Confirm the Metal on a Piece You Own?

On a certified piece, the metal is printed on the label and you should treat that as the answer, since it was assessed with the piece in hand and out of its holder.

On a raw piece, weight and colour are the practical guides. White metal is noticeably light for its size and rings dull. Brass is yellow and heavier. Copper shows warm brown tones under good light. Gilt shows a different colour where the plating has worn at high points, which is often the giveaway.

Avoid destructive testing. A campaign medal is a struck historical object, and a scratch test to satisfy curiosity permanently reduces what it is worth. Frequently asked questions

Does the metal change the catalog number?
No. The number stays the same because it describes the design. The metal is recorded separately, which is why holders print both.
What does WM mean on a campaign medal holder?
White metal, a soft tin-based alloy used widely for nineteenth-century campaign pieces because it was inexpensive and took a sharp impression from the dies.
Is white metal the same as silver?
No. White metal is a base alloy that merely looks silvery. Genuine silver strikings are abbreviated AR and are typically far scarcer.
Why is a gilt medal sometimes worth more than a silver one?
Because value follows demand and condition as well as scarcity. A well-preserved gilt example of a popular design can outsell a problem silver striking of the same number.
What do RD, RB and BN mean?
They are colour designations for copper and brass pieces: red, red brown and brown. They describe how much original surface colour survives and can change value significantly at the same numeric grade.
Should I clean a dull white metal medal?
No. Cleaning removes original surface and will earn a Details grade rather than a straight grade, which usually costs more value than the improved appearance gains.
